Taxonomic Classification

Rank Black Duiker Japanese Water Shrew
Kingdom same Animalia (动物界) Animalia (动物界)
Phylum same Chordata (脊索动物门) Chordata (脊索动物门)
Class same Mammalia (哺乳動物) Mammalia (哺乳動物)
Order Artiodactyla (偶蹄目) Soricomorpha (鼩形目)
Family Bovidae (Bovids) Soricidae
Genus Cephalophus Chimarrogale
Species Cephalophus niger Chimarrogale platycephalus

Evolutionary Relationship

Black Duiker and Japanese Water Shrew share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(哺乳動物)
